2.1. Crafting Journeys: What Does a Travel Agent Do?
What are the responsibilities of a travel agent and how do they assist travelers in planning their trips?
A travel agent acts as a bridge between travelers and the complex world of travel arrangements. They handle a wide array of tasks, from offering destination advice and booking transportation to arranging lodging and providing insights into local customs. Travel agents alleviate the stress of planning, especially for busy individuals or those unfamiliar with their destinations. Their expertise ensures that travelers have seamless and enjoyable experiences.
According to the American Society of Travel Advisors (ASTA), the role of travel agents is evolving to encompass more personalized and experiential travel planning. As travelers seek unique and authentic experiences, travel agents are becoming increasingly valuable in curating customized itineraries that cater to individual preferences.
- Offers advice on travel destinations
- Plans and books transportation
- Helps clients learn about local customs
- Advises clients about travel requirements
2.2. Designing Experiences: What is the Role of a Tour Operator?
What are the responsibilities of a tour operator and how do they create travel packages?
Tour operators are the architects of travel experiences, developing comprehensive travel packages that encompass transportation, accommodation, meals, and itineraries. They meticulously plan every detail to ensure a seamless and memorable journey for travelers. Tour operators often specialize in specific destinations or types of travel, allowing them to create highly curated and engaging experiences.
The European Tour Operators Association (ETOA) emphasizes the importance of sustainability and responsible tourism practices in tour operations. As travelers become more conscious of their environmental and social impact, tour operators are increasingly incorporating sustainable practices into their packages, such as supporting local businesses and minimizing environmental footprint.
- Develops travel packages
- Markets packages to travel agents
- Plans transportation, lodging, meals, and itineraries
2.3. Guiding Explorers: What Does a Tour Guide Do?
What are the responsibilities of a tour guide and how do they enhance the travel experience?
Tour guides are the storytellers of the tourism industry, bringing destinations to life with their knowledge and passion. They lead travelers through historical sites, cultural landmarks, and natural wonders, sharing insights and anecdotes that enrich the experience. Tour guides not only provide information but also create a connection with travelers, fostering a deeper appreciation for the destination.
According to the National Tour Association (NTA), successful tour guides possess not only extensive knowledge but also exceptional communication and interpersonal skills. They must be able to adapt to diverse audiences, answer questions effectively, and create an engaging and memorable experience for every traveler.
- Leads tourists through specific sites
- Discusses history, culture, and architecture
- Answers questions from tourists
2.4. Creating Memorable Stays: What Does a Hotel Manager Do?
What are the responsibilities of a hotel manager and how do they ensure guest satisfaction?
Hotel managers are the orchestrators of the guest experience, ensuring that every aspect of a hotel operation runs smoothly and efficiently. From maintaining the aesthetic appeal of the property to supervising staff and managing budgets, their responsibilities are diverse and demanding. Hotel managers strive to create a welcoming and comfortable environment for guests, ensuring that their stay is memorable and enjoyable.
The American Hotel & Lodging Association (AHLA) emphasizes the importance of customer service and guest satisfaction in hotel management. Hotel managers must be adept at addressing guest concerns, resolving issues promptly, and creating a culture of service excellence within their teams.
- Evaluates grounds and guest rooms
- Supervises and coordinates activities across departments
- Hires and trains staff members
- Monitors the guest experience
2.5. Curating Wine Experiences: What Does a Sommelier Do?
What are the responsibilities of a sommelier and how do they enhance the dining experience?
Sommeliers are the wine experts of the hospitality industry, possessing a deep knowledge of wine varietals, regions, and pairings. They work in fine dining establishments, curating wine lists, advising guests on selections, and ensuring that wine is served properly. Sommeliers elevate the dining experience by providing expert guidance and enhancing the enjoyment of food and wine.
The Court of Master Sommeliers is the leading professional association for sommeliers, offering a rigorous certification program that recognizes expertise and professionalism. Certification as a sommelier is highly regarded in the industry, demonstrating a commitment to excellence and a deep understanding of wine.
- Handles wine purchasing, storage, and service
- Pairs wines with food
- Explains the wine selection to guests
- Offers recommendations and serves the wine

6. Educational Foundations: How Can a Hospitality Management Degree Help?
How can a degree in hospitality management provide a strong foundation for a successful tourism career?
A hospitality management degree provides a solid foundation for a successful tourism career. The curriculum covers a wide range of topics, from hotel and lodging operations to food and beverage service management. You will learn about guest relations, interdepartmental coordination, human resources, food sanitation, cost control, and marketing strategies.
The Association to Advance Collegiate Schools of Business (AACSB) emphasizes the importance of practical experience in hospitality management education. Many degree programs incorporate internships, industry projects, and simulations to provide students with hands-on learning opportunities.
6.1. Key Topics Covered in a Hospitality Management Degree Program
- Hotel and lodging operations: Operational procedures, guest relations, and interdepartmental coordination.
- Food and beverage service management: Daily operations, human resources, food sanitation, and safety.
- Communication strategies: Building strong relationships with guests, vendors, and stakeholders.
- Event planning and management: Organizing events within the tourism industry.
- Brand management and tourism services marketing: Developing marketing campaigns and strategies.

8. Navigating Challenges: Addressing Common Concerns About Tourism Careers
What are some common concerns or challenges associated with tourism careers and how can you address them?
Like any career path, tourism presents its own set of challenges. Irregular work schedules, seasonal fluctuations in demand, and the need to handle demanding customers can be stressful. However, by developing strong coping mechanisms, prioritizing self-care, and maintaining a positive attitude, you can overcome these challenges and thrive in the industry.
The Tourism Concern organization advocates for fair and ethical labor practices in the tourism industry. It’s important to be aware of your rights as an employee and to seek out companies that prioritize the well-being of their staff.
8.1. Common Challenges and Solutions
Challenge | Solution |
---|---|
Irregular work schedules | Develop a flexible lifestyle, prioritize self-care, and communicate your needs to your employer. |
Seasonal fluctuations in demand | Budget wisely, seek out additional training during off-season, and explore opportunities for diversification. |
Handling demanding customers | Develop strong communication and problem-solving skills, remain calm and professional, and seek support from your colleagues and supervisors. |
Low wages and limited benefits | Research industry standards, negotiate your salary and benefits, and seek out companies that offer competitive compensation packages. |
Job insecurity | Develop a strong network, continuously improve your skills, and be prepared to adapt to changing market conditions. |
